US and Russia are Needed for Nuclear Arms Control

Richard Lugar, US Senator, & Sam Nunn, former US Senator | June 2

Cooperation between Russia and the US on issues of nonproliferation is vital for America's national security. ++ The agreement now before the US Congress would help the US and Russia create an international fuel bank that could provide nuclear-fuel services internationally and thus undercut countries who falsely claim to be perusing uranium enrichment for civilian purposes. ++ While Russia should do more to hinder Iran's progress toward nuclear weapons, rejecting the US-Russian agreement on these grounds is illogical and likely to backfire.
